Effective low-level laser therapy
Laser therapy has established itself as a versatile method in numerous therapeutic fields of application. Today, powerful low-level infrared diode lasers with up to 700 mW are used in physical therapy in particular. These are characterized by a high penetration depth, pronounced biostimulative effects and user-friendly handling.
FI bands (Frequency Integrated) in modern laser therapy: In the therapeutic application of laser light, pulsed frequencies have become established for the targeted support of various indications and enable the automatic sequence of recommended laser frequencies for certain indications. This form of application is known as laser frequency therapy or laser field therapy. Instead of setting each frequency manually, the programs in the FI band run automatically in a 15-second rhythm (AUTORUN) without interrupting the therapy. The currently active frequency is shown on the display. This saves time, reduces input errors and optimizes the therapy flow.
